/* PHP symbol index + reference lookup.
*
* Two jobs, both on ripgrep:
* - the index: every class/interface/trait/enum DECLARED in the project, as
* name → {path, line}. The renderer needs the bare name list to decide which
* tokens it may underline, and that decision is per visible token per frame,
* so it cannot be a search. One rg pass answers it for every token at once.
* - the lookup: on ⌘-click, the declarations of one name plus every reference
* to it, found there and then. Nothing about usages is cached.
*
* The index is built lazily and never on the startup path: the first caller
* starts it and later callers join the same promise. A file change drops it, so
* the next caller pays for the rebuild (~100 ms) instead of the window opening.
*/

/* Which PHP class names this project declares.
*
* A module-level Set rather than React state: `HL.hlText` marks the tokens
* while it builds the HTML, and it is called from four memos that have no
* business carrying a prop for it. Components that render code subscribe with
* `useSymbols()` and put the version in their memo deps, so highlighting
* recomputes once when the list lands — and never again while it is unchanged.
*
* The list is fetched on demand and the main process builds it lazily, so
* nothing here is on the startup path. Until it arrives the Set is empty, which
* simply means no token is underlined yet.
*/
